ULTIMATE BEEF TENDERLOIN
Ultimate Beef Tenderloin is flavorful and rich. Prep the roast with salt, pepper, and butter then just pop it in the oven. It's the easiest tenderloin ever!
Provided by Sabrina Snyder
Categories Dinner
Time 30m
Number Of Ingredients 4
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 500 degrees.
- Tie tenderloin with kitchen twine so it is an even thickness all the way across.
- Rub the tenderloin with softened butter and season with kosher salt and pepper.
- Place into a large oven-safe skillet or baking pan (a cast iron skillet works great for this).
- Roast for 22-25 minutes for medium-rare (135 degrees), then let rest for 10 minutes (tented with a sheet of foil) before cutting slices against the grain to serve.

CHIPOTLE JAVA RUBBED TENDERLOIN
Steps:
- Rinse tenderloin with cold water and pat dry with paper towels. Tie with butcher string to hold together and give tenderloin a uniform thickness. Set aside.
- Combine remaining ingredients and rub into tenderloin. Wrap in plastic wrap and refrigerate for 2 hours.
- Set up grill for direct cooking over medium heat. Oil grill grate when ready to start cooking.
- Remove tenderloin from refrigerator 30 minutes before grilling.
- Grill until desired doneness, about 20 minutes for medium-rare (internal temperature of 145 degrees F on an instant-read thermometer), turning a quarter turn every 10 minutes. Remove from grill and let tenderloin rest 5 to 10 minutes.
- Slice tenderloin in 1/2-inch slices. Serve immediately.
